History has been made on your birthday. The following are important historical events that occurred on July 3
| Year | Event |
|---|---|
| 324 | Battle of Adrianople: Constantine I defeats Licinius, who flees to Byzantium. |
| 987 | Hugh Capet is crowned King of France, the first of the Capetian dynasty that would rule France until the French Revolution in 1792. |
| 1035 | William the Conqueror becomes the Duke of Normandy, reigning until 1087. |
| 1608 | Québec City is founded by Samuel de Champlain. |
| 1754 | French and Indian War: George Washington surrenders Fort Necessity to French forces. |
| 1767 | Norway's oldest newspaper still in print, Adresseavisen, is founded and the first edition is published. |
| 1767 | Pitcairn Island is discovered by Midshipman Robert Pitcairn on an expeditionary voyage commanded by Philip Carteret. |
| 1775 | American Revolutionary War: George Washington takes command of the Continental Army at Cambridge, Massachusetts. |
| 1778 | American Revolutionary War: Iroquois allied to Britain kill 360 people in the Wyoming Valley massacre. |
| 1819 | The Bank for Savings in the City of New-York, the first savings bank in the United States, opens. |
